Florida State Football: Winners and Losers from Week 7's Game vs. Boston College

Austyn HumphreyOct 15, 2012

Now that's a turnaround!

I honestly expected the Florida State Seminoles to come out playing cautiously against the Boston College Eagles. Instead, the Seminoles played loose and had their most complete game of this football season.

EJ Manuel aired the ball so much that he must have doubled his frequent flyer miles.

For the detractors, a short statement. Yes, the Seminoles' national title hopes are almost certainly dashed. But the team responded to their adversity strongly.

Don't get me wrong. Like you, I would have loved to see the Seminoles reach the BCS National Championship Game. But remember, this team hasn't won the ACC yet—it is a tad unfair to expect them to go from crawling to running without some walking in between.

But what matters is that FSU continues to gain experience and play well. If this trend continues, expect that elusive ACC crown.

Boston College definitely won't win it.

Winner: EJ Manuel

1 of 6

Sure, he had two picks.

But look at the conglomeration of his work—439 yards and four touchdowns in the air. The Seminoles haven't seen that caliber of stats since Chris Weinke won the 2000 Heisman Trophy.

Manuel went 27-of-34 Saturday, completing 79.4 percent of his passes. He averaged nearly 13 yards per completion and completely trashed BC's defense.

Now if Manuel can have another day like that in Miami Gardens, maybe (just maybe) he can make the top five in Heisman voting in December.

Stat of the week: Manuel has a 175.8 quarterback rating, good for fifth nationally.

Loser: Chase Rettig

2 of 6

Chase Rettig didn't even go .500 when it came to passing.

Combine that with a mere four yards per completion, and you have an all right quarterback who just had a bad day.

Winner: Devonta Freeman

3 of 6

Jimbo Fisher decided to play smartly again.

Instead of working Chris Thompson to death, Coach Fisher did the obvious: hand the rock to Devonta Freeman. Freeman went for 70 yards on the ground on eight attempts; Thompson went for 68 yards on 10 attempts.

Winner: Jimbo Fisher

4 of 6

Jimbo increased the rushing output significantly in the Doak. The Seminoles nearly doubled their rushing output, going from 125 yards to 201 yards against BC.

By switching Freeman and Chris Thompson, he kept his duo refreshed and ready to go. Each of the two had plenty of time to recover, with EJ Manuel airing the ball out more often.

Overall, it was a perfect game plan for a team that needed to spread the wealth on offense.

Loser: Frank Spaziani

5 of 6

Anyone who watches a Frank Spaziani press conference knows the guy has a warm sense of humor and a great smile.

Unfortunately, that won't win you conference championships or get you to bowl games.

BC has fallen to 1-5, and a bowl game is extraordinarily unlikely. Combine that with his age (he is in his mid-60s) and this faithful BC man should do what is best for the program and step aside.

Winner: Dustin Hopkins

6 of 6

A total of 402 points—an ACC all-time record and fifth all time in his NCAA category.

Dustin Hopkins has made 402 total points from combined field goals and extra points.

Let me illustrate how amazing that is.

I'll assign each touchdown the basic value of six points (we all know Hopkins makes it seven, but that would lower the number I'm trying to convey).

Hopkins has scored 67 touchdowns in his career.

(Second) Stat of the Week: Hopkins is averaging 10.9 points per game.
